# Break-glass: TumbleVault locker flow

Future maintainers: if the TumbleVault laundry-locker access flow dies (residents can't open lockers, app shows spinner forever), you can force all lockers into attendant mode from the Fennley admin panel. Use sparingly — it logs loudly and pages facilities. The panel asks for the emergency override before switching modes, so type the passphrase below.

vault phrase of kawep-tahog = ulaix-briath

## Authentication

Formula sandbox service (Quenchwell) requires a service token. All user-supplied formulas execute inside the sandbox; nothing runs in the host process. No token, no evaluation — requests fail closed with a 403. Release builds must ship with the production token baked into the sealed config, not the env file. Staging and prod tokens are not interchangeable. Rotation happens each release cycle; confirm the token matches the cut before tagging. Current production sandbox token follows.

gateway credential: kto23_LX9A4ys6i4nzHtpOLNLodKK

## Service Account: Pulsegate Health Checker

The Fernbrook load balancer probes each Pulsegate node every ten seconds via `/healthz`. These probes authenticate as the dedicated `pulsegate-probe` service account, which holds read-only status scope and nothing else. Support staff verifying probe failures manually should authenticate using the key below.

service key, yadug-bajog: zpat3_pou